Problem

Existing harnesses for carrying heavy hand-held motor-driven tools like clearing saws often result in uneven load distribution and limited movement due to rigid connections, causing strain and discomfort, especially for professional operators who need to move freely in dense environments.

Innovation Solution

A carrier assembly with a pivotal connection joint between the back plate and hip belt allows rotation about an axis perpendicular to the back plate, enabling increased freedom of movement and optimal weight distribution through a recess and tongue-shaped member design with a resilient tab and snap-fit connection.

Engineering Contradictions & Design Principles

VSEngineering Contradiction Analysis

1Stability of the object's composition

If a rigid connection is used between the back plate and hip belt to maintain stable weight distribution, then weight distribution stability is improved, but operator freedom of movement deteriorates

Engineering Contradiction:
Improveweight distribution stabilityVSAvoidoperator freedom of movement
Core Design Contradiction:
Stability of the object's compositionVSEase of operation

Solution Approach 1:

The patent applies the dynamics principle by replacing the rigid fixed connection with a pivotal connection joint that allows rotational movement. The back plate can pivot relative to the hip belt around a vertical axis, enabling the harness to adapt dynamically to the operator's movements while maintaining weight distribution. This dynamic connection resolves the contradiction by providing both stability in weight bearing and freedom in movement.

AI summary

A carrier assembly for a harness for carrying a handheld motor-driven work tool, the carrier assembly including a back plate having connections for shoulder straps, a hip belt, and a manner for attaching the work tool. The back plate is arranged to be connected to the hip belt by a pivotal connection joint to allow rotation about an axis substantially perpendicular to a plane defined by the back plate.
